Two very different things......similar functionality. IA is the data profiling component of v8....ProfileStage is a pre-8 data profiling and much of the inspiration for IA, but vastly different set up and GUI skills. Which are you using?
I don't have any "tutorials" per se, but there are certainly pointers to each that will ease a few early bumps.
